'This is my new skin care range. It’s called Good Things because it’s full of superfruit beauty boosters – extracts of goji berry, lychee, mango, fig and so on – to brighten, clear and soothe the skin.  The formulations are gentle but super-effective and free from parabens, sulphates, mineral oil and animal-tested ingredients. It’s affordable, too – everything costs less than £10. There are wipes, cleansers, moisturisers, a skin-freshening exfoliating polish, a pick-me-up face-mask and a great spot-zapping gel, one of three products designed to help clear oilier skin.

'Good Things is designed for young skin – for girls in their teens and twenties – though it works well for anyone. Some of my more mature testers have told me they’re particularly keen on Bright Eyes, the de-puffing eye-cream, and Dream Cream night cream. It’s available exclusively at Boots, from Monday 5 July 2010. I hope you like it.'
